On Friday 29 August 2014 16:15:44 Alessandro Ghedini wrote: > Actually, it is. rakudo needs to use at runtime the specific nqp build used > to build rakudo itself. If you update the nqp package (or just rebuilt it > without any change) without rebuilding rakudo too, rakudo stops working and > spews
